AFTER being displaced from Dr Martens Western top spot following three months leading the pack, Bromsgrove Rovers could only manage a goalless draw against third placed Weston-Super-Mare at The Victoria Ground.

The visitors opened strongly, with Matt Lowe saving Jody Bevan's header from Jonathan Miller's cross on 11 minutes.

The home team were forced to make an early substitution when Steve Frost was unable to continue after a clash with Michael Jackson. He was replaced by Matt Southwick.

On 19 minutes, Ryan Cross had a shot blocked by Steve Pope, Stuart Slate struck a free-kick straight at Lowe and Kevin Banner cleared Bevan's shot off the line on the stroke of half time.

Rovers had few chances in the first period. Substitute Southwick shot wide on 18 minutes and then, in first half injury time, Steve Lutz miskicked in front of goal after good work by Les Palmer and goalkeeper Stuart Jones saving from Southwick.

Weston's David Mehew saw a header go just wide on 57 minutes before a frantic last 30 minutes saw both teams have chances to take maximum points.

Denied

On 65 minutes Southwick's close range shot was palmed away by Jones and two minutes from time Jones denied Lutz's header with a low save on the goal line.

Weston had a great opportunity to secure maximum points, but James Edwards fired over from close range with only Lowe to beat.

In injury time Darren Bullock created an opportunity for Bromsgrove's man of the match Paul Danks, but the striker hit his shot narrowly wide.
